The Michigan Department of Licencing and Regulatory Affairs and the Department of Health and Human Services needs to, at bare minimum, conduct a mystery/secrect shop audit so they can see what really goes on behind closed doors. -------------- My loved one was transferred to the rehab here after a hospital stay. Rehab, not nursing home. This is a place where he was supposed to regain some strength and mobility. He had developed a manageable bed sore in the hospital. This bed sore grew exponentially in size and severity during the approx. 2 weeks he was here and looked infected. He was not receiving proper wound care or meaningful repositioning. The standard for bed-bound patients is to reposition them every 2 hours at minimum - particularly if a bed sore is already present. This was NOT DONE. He often waited very long periods of time in his own urine and/or excrement before being changed, greatly increasing the risk of bed sore infection in this sensitive area. He went into septic shock due to an infection and passed away. DO NOT entrust this place with your loved ones who may require any sort of advanced care or wound care.     We needed to help a dear friend move to a memory care facility in summer of 2019. We searched,…read morevisited, and interviewed sites. We were so grateful to find St. Anne's Mead on 12 Mile in Southfield. There are various approaches to memory care but we really like SAM's approach the best. They utilize an approach called Best Buddy...where SAM actually hires someone to keep the seniors engaged informally. They have PT and OT of course elsewhere, but I love that this person's main role is to sit with a resident to share a cup of coffee or visit with someone alone on a couch, etc. The Program Director has a very sweet little dog she brings 3 days a week and the residents light up when they get to hold or pet her. The staff are all very respectful of the residents and do seem to like them greatly. They have many activities scheduled throughout the day so there is no sitting and staring at the television for hours. Their meals are delicious. As noted by other reviewers, the building is an old-style nursing home, but the interactions, smiles, and kind staff make it a very hospitable place. The memory care unit was recently renovated with nice size rooms and large private half-baths (showers without assistance can be quite dangerous for seniors with memory issues). They have their own dining area and integrate into the activities of the larger facility as much as possible. Don't be put off that the building is from the 1960's. It has everything you will need for quality care for your loved one who is struggling with memory issues.
